Bright Haven Learning Academy is committed to making this website usable for everyone, including people who rely on screen readers, keyboard navigation, or other assistive technology. We aim to meet the Web Content Accessibility Guidelines (WCAG) 2.2 at Level AA.

What we do

  • Build with semantic HTML, clear headings, and landmark regions, plus a skip-to-content link.
  • Support full keyboard navigation with a visible focus outline on every control.
  • Write descriptive alternative text for images and hide decorative graphics from screen readers.
  • Meet AA color-contrast targets and never use color as the only way to convey meaning.
  • Pair every form field with a visible label and honor reduced-motion preferences.

A work in progress

Accessibility is ongoing, not a one-time fix. We test as we build and review any third-party tools, such as forms and maps, before they go live. If something isn't working for you, we want to know.
